After a disappointing meet, I'm back to heavy training. I decided to take one more day off P90X but didn't miss a day in the pool. Today I trained at EMU. I have to thank Coach Peter Linn for the 7,000 (I had time for 3,600) yard workout I recycled from my college days. It was a solid reminder of how difficult those college practices could be. I stepped on the scale after the 1 hour workout and yet again, I hold steady at 178.6 lbs. I find it interesting that I haven't lost any weight since I began training again. Lately I've been averaging about 1.25 workouts a day. I'd really like to get that number closer to 2.0 being comprised of one swim workout and one dryland/P90X workout.

Tonight is Chest/Back which begins my 2nd week of the program!

As I think about my 53.26 second 100 Backstroke from Sunday I feel that if I actually do get back to the 49's or lower, it will be my greatest comeback of my life. Looking back at my year to year progress, in 2005 I swam a 53.29 by doing literally zero training. In 2006 I swam a 51.81, only a 1.48 second drop. In reality I need to drop about 4+ seconds from where I am to actually be where I want to be. I know what it will take, and I'm willing to do what needs to be done.

Today I did some power kicking drills and power pulling drills. I have a long way to go.
